Note: You must back up the data (files and documents) before troubleshooting on the corrupted volume, because there is a risk of data loss if the C: volume is damaged or unusable.

I suggest that you run the CHKDSK utility in the Windows recovery environment.

1. put the Windows Vista or Windows 7 installation disc in the disc drive, and then start the computer.
2. press a key when you are prompted.
3. Select a language, a time, a currency, a keyboard or an input method, and then click Next.
4. click on repair your computer.
5. click on the operating system that you want to repair, and then click Next.
6. in the System Recovery Options dialog box, click command prompt.

At the command prompt, type:

CHKDSK [drive:] [/ p] | [/ r]

[drive:] Specifies the drive to check.

/ p check even if the drive is not marked dirty, bad.

/r locates bad sectors and recovers readable information (implies / p).

  • corrupted file? Run the chkdsk utility?

    I am trying to open some of my files and it always tells me that the file is damaged and unreadable. Please run the Chkdsk utility... I searched my computer for "chkdsk utility" and can't find that. Help, please!

    Open my computer, click on the drive (for example, drive C) > properties > Tools tab > difficulty check now, put a check mark automatically file system errors > start.

    If you receive the message that it cannot be done at the moment, you want to plan for the next reboot of the computer, answer Yes.

  • Corrupted file system

    Hello

    A required clarification.

    If the file system data is corrupted, what is the way before raising the DB up and running.

    Thank you
    Sheen

    With rman, restore system tablespace on its original location:
    [oracle@localhost ~] target rman $ /.
    RMAN > startup mount;
    RMAN > restore tablespace system;
    RMAN > recover tablespace system;
    RMAN > alter database open;

    On a different site:
    [oracle@localhost ~] target rman $ /.
    RMAN > startup mount;
    RMAN > run {}
    the value of newname for datafile 1 to ' / home/oracle/app/oracle/oradata/orcl/non_default_location/system01.dbf';
    system restore of tablespace;
    switch datafile;
    recover the system tablespace.
    ALTER database open;
    }

    You should have a valid backup...

    Hello

    Many files that SFC cannot resolve are not important.

    Start - type in the search box-> find CMD in top - click right on - RUN AS ADMIN

    put the command from below (copy and paste) in this box and her and then press ENTER.

    findstr/c: "[SR]" %windir%\logs\cbs\cbs.log > sfcdetails.txt

    who creates the sfcdetails.txt file in the folder that you are in when you run it.

    So if you're in C:\Windows\System32 > then you will need to look in that folder for the file.

    How to analyze the log file entries that the Microsoft Windows Resource Checker (SFC.exe) program
    in Windows Vista
    http://support.Microsoft.com/kb/928228

    This creates sfcdetails.txt in C:\Windows\System32 find and you can post the errors in a message
    here. NOTE: there are probably duplicates so please only post once each section error.

    You can read the newspaper/txt files easier if you right click on Notepad or Wordpad then RUN AS ADMIN - then
    You can navigate to sfcdetails.txt (in C:\Windows\System32) or cbs.log (in C:\Windows\Logs) as needed.
    (You may need to search sfcdetails.txt if it is not created in the default folders.)

    I don't see you mention on running "chkdsk".
    So, do you?

    How to run the check disk (chkdsk)... assuming you are using Vista

    Start button > Search box, type cmd > look up, right-click on cmd.exe > Run As Administrator >

    in the black and white window, at the command prompt flashes, type chkdsk/f/r > press the Enter key.
    Note: there is a space between 'chkdsk' and ' / '.
    The screen will say something like cannot do it now, but you want to run it on reboot. Click on 'y' as in Yes > press > window cmd of output.
     
    Restart your computer. It will take a while. DO NOT stop the machine. Just wait.
